    Purpose of the post

    The PPASS service aims to improve and enhance the West Glamorgan regional advocacy network by creating a new form of peer advocacy and peer support for parents who are going through the child protection process, statutory assessment and/or the looked after children system within the Neath, Port Talbot and Swansea area.

    Main duties

    • To provide an advocacy service for parents who are going through the child protection process, statutory assessment and/or the looked after children system
    • Provide advocacy support, to clients which may include accompanying clients to meetings, or support in writing letter to represent and/or negotiate on their behalf as requested.
    • To work in such a way as to encourage clients to self-advocate as much as possible via training/coaching/rehearsing
    • To provide clear information to enable clients to understand their rights and to make informed choices on options available to them
    • Undertaking promotional activities across West Glamorgan to promote the service in line with an agreed promotional plan.
    • Attending various meetings as requested by the council which may relate to promoting, reviewing and evaluating the service.
    • To make and maintain secure, accurate and confidential case records
    • To maintain contacts in the community
    • Work alongside the peer support workers to provide a wrap-around service for the clients.
    • In conjunction with the manager actively develop and maintain links with other advocacy groups within Neath, Port Talbot and Swansea.
